Ilkay Gundogan joins Barca

Ilkay Gundogan, the captain of Manchester City, departs the organisation after a treble-winning campaign to join LaLiga champions. Gundogan, a player for Germany, spent seven years at Etihad Stadium, and Pep Guardiola had expressed a desire to keep him in Manchester.

Ilkay Gundogan, the captain of Manchester City, departed the club to join Barcelona after his contract expired.

With trophies for the Premier League, FA Cup, and Champions League in less than a month, Gundogan leaves Manchester after the club’s most successful season.

Since moving from Borussia Dortmund to the Etihad Stadium in 2016, he has been there for seven years. Manager Pep Guardiola has openly expressed a desire to keep him there longer.

In advance of his contract expiring at the end of this week, Gundogan was in negotiations with City on a new agreement.

The 32-year-old was offered a one-year contract with a 12-month option, but this was a deal-breaker for him. As a result, he signed a two-year agreement with LaLiga winners Barcelona instead, which also included a 12-month option. His release clause is worth €400 million (£342 million).

“For me, it has been a total privilege and pleasure to be part of Manchester City for the last seven years,” Gundogan said on the Manchester City club website.

“Manchester has been my home and I have felt part of a very special family at City.

“I have been lucky to have experienced so many unforgettable moments in my time here and to have been captain for this extra special season has been the greatest experience of my career.

“First, I would like to thank Pep. To have been able to play under and learn from him for so long has been something I will never forget.

“I would also like to thank all my team-mates – past and present – who have all played such a special part in making my time here so amazing.

“Finally, I would like to thank the incredible City fans. They have supported me from the moment I arrived, and I owe them all so much for their support.

“This club made me realise all my dreams and I will forever be thankful for this opportunity.

“I will carry City always in my heart. Once a blue, always a blue.”
